Step into a dazzling celebration of two of the greatest musical icons of our time with Piano Legends: Forever Elton and Joel, a spectacular theatre show celebrating the timeless hits of Billy Joel and Elton John. Led by the multi award-winning composer and musical director Phil Mountford, this tribute band brings the magic of two of the greatest piano men to life with electrifying performances.

From the soulful ballads of "Your Song" and "She's Always a Woman" to the high-energy anthems like "Crocodile Rock" and "Uptown Girl," Piano Legends: Forever Elton and Joel delivers a powerhouse setlist that spans decades of chart-topping classics. With virtuosic piano playing, soaring vocals, and a dynamic live band, every note is infused with passion and precision.

With so many hits to cover, the non-stop, back-to-back song list includes "Rocket Man", "Bennie and the Jets", "Piano Man" and "We Didn't Start the Fire" will definitely keep the crowd singing along.

Phil Mountford’s masterful arrangements and charismatic stage presence elevate the experience, offering audiences not just a concert, but a journey through the iconic soundscapes that defined generations. Whether you're a lifelong fan or discovering these legends anew, Piano Legends: Forever Elton and Joel promises an unforgettable evening of nostalgia, artistry, and pure musical joy.

Join us for a celebration of two extraordinary legacies—where the piano takes centre stage and the music never stops.
